Unless the shipment is released pursuant to Section 21233 or 21744, no common carrier, or owner or driver of any conveyance shall receive for transportation or transport any cattle until they have been inspected, and the carrier, owner, or driver has been furnished with duplicate brand inspection certificates that are signed by an inspector, which show all of the following:
(a) Any brands and marks.
(b) The names of the shipper and consignee.
(c) The origin and destination of the shipment.
